Campbellsville is moderately more affordable than Williamstown, with a 7.2% lower cost of living index. Campbellsville scores 64 compared to 69 for Williamstown, where the US average is 100. This difference means residents of Williamstown can expect to pay noticeably more for everyday expenses, housing, and services.

On the housing front, median rent in Campbellsville is $657/month compared to $770/month in Williamstown — a 15% difference. Interestingly, home values tell a different story: while Campbellsville has cheaper rent, Williamstown actually has lower median home values ($159,100 vs $162,900).

Median household income in Campbellsville is $49,389 compared to $71,761 in Williamstown (-31.2%). While Williamstown is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Campbellsville spend roughly 16% of their income on rent, more than the 12.9% in Williamstown.
